Poplins are both soft to the touch and yet strong and durable. A poplin shirt is thin, lightweight and does not lock in heat making it suitable for warm climates. It can be more prone to wrinkling than a twill (though a warm iron or light steam smooths it out quickly and effortlessly) and can be slightly transparent, especially in white. Its lack of texture makes it a popular shirt that stands up well to rigorous, regular use.
